91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

redis存儲引擎如何升級

小樊
83
2024-11-14 18:57:29
欄目: 云計算

Redis 是一個開源的內存數據結構存儲系統,通常用于緩存、消息隊列、實時分析等場景。Redis 的存儲引擎主要是基于內存的,但也可以配置持久化選項,將數據存儲到磁盤上。

如果你想要升級 Redis 的存儲引擎或者相關的配置,可以按照以下步驟進行:

1. 確認當前 Redis 版本和配置

首先,你需要確認當前使用的 Redis 版本以及相關的配置文件。你可以通過以下命令查看當前版本:

redis-cli --version

查看配置文件的位置:

redis-cli config get config_file

2. 升級 Redis 版本

如果你需要升級 Redis 版本,可以按照以下步驟進行:

2.1 下載新版本

從 Redis 官方網站下載新版本的 Redis:https://redis.io/download

2.2 停止舊版本 Redis

在升級之前,確保停止正在運行的舊版本 Redis 服務:

sudo systemctl stop redis

或者,如果你使用的是其他進程管理工具(如 Supervisor),按照相應的步驟停止 Redis 服務。

2.3 安裝新版本 Redis

按照下載頁面上的說明安裝新版本的 Redis。例如,在 Ubuntu 上,你可以使用以下命令:

wget http://download.redis.io/redis-stable.tar.gz
tar xvzf redis-stable.tar.gz
cd redis-stable
make
sudo make install

2.4 配置新版本 Redis

你可以將新版本的 Redis 配置文件復制到舊版本的位置,或者直接在新版本目錄中使用默認配置文件。

3. 升級存儲引擎配置

如果你需要升級存儲引擎相關的配置,可以按照以下步驟進行:

3.1 查看當前存儲引擎配置

你可以通過以下命令查看當前的存儲引擎配置:

redis-cli CONFIG GET engine

3.2 修改配置文件

根據你的需求修改 Redis 配置文件(通常位于 /etc/redis/redis.conf/etc/redis/redis.conf)。例如,如果你想要使用 RDB 持久化,確保以下配置項存在且正確:

save 900 1
save 300 10
save 60 10000

如果你想要使用 AOF 持久化,確保以下配置項存在且正確:

appendonly yes
appendfilename "appendonly.aof"

3.3 重啟 Redis 服務

修改配置文件后,重啟 Redis 服務以應用新的配置:

sudo systemctl restart redis

或者,如果你使用的是其他進程管理工具(如 Supervisor),按照相應的步驟重啟 Redis 服務。

4. 驗證升級

最后,你可以通過以下命令驗證 Redis 是否成功升級并確認存儲引擎配置是否正確:

redis-cli CONFIG GET engine

通過以上步驟,你應該能夠成功升級 Redis 的存儲引擎和相關配置。如果在升級過程中遇到問題,建議查看 Redis 的官方文檔或尋求社區支持。

0
西平县| 云霄县| 扶绥县| 积石山| 托克托县| 黑水县| 乌海市| 温州市| 晋城| 唐海县| 合水县| 黔江区| 丽水市| 婺源县| 平泉县| 米脂县| 瑞金市| 密云县| 广宁县| 屏东市| 四平市| 青海省| 聂荣县| 延庆县| 突泉县| 余干县| 诸城市| 文山县| 陕西省| 柞水县| 榆树市| 林西县| 临猗县| 博野县| 循化| 承德县| 宁武县| 五寨县| 荃湾区| 昭平县| 广丰县|